VC2E4LY09
use comprehension strategies, such as visualising, predicting, connecting, summarising, monitoring and questioning, to expand topic knowledge and ideas, and begin to evaluate texts to build literal and inferred meanings
- making connections between information in print, images and sound
- reading or listening for key topic-specific vocabulary words to build understanding
- reading or listening to interpret the main idea and supporting ideas
- identifying evidence and reasoning used by authors to support points or arguments
- applying self-monitoring strategies such as re-reading, pausing and questioning, and self-correction strategies such as confirming and cross-checking
- connecting the use of colours, images, symbols and patterns in texts by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ander authors and illustrators
- evaluating an author’s use of evidence to support arguments
